金冶炼酸性含砷废水处理工艺研究

Treatment of Arsenic-containing Acidic Wastewater From Gold Metallurgical Process

Abstract

By lime‐chlorinated lime‐ferrous sulfate process and lime‐polymeric ferric sulfate‐PAM process ,removal of arsenic from the arsenic‐containing acidic wastewater from a gold metallurgical plant was researched .The results show that the wastewater can be emission on standard after being treated by the two processes but the later is with lower cost .The best conditions are pH of 9 -10 , m(PFS)/m(As)of 15/1 ,PAM addition of 12 g/m3 ,agitating time of 10 min ,settling time of 1 .5-2 .0 h .
